Hi, phoned to 'cancel' my contract, was on O2 online 200 (200 min/500 txt £30 per month)

Was offered and accepted 12 month contract 500 min/500 txt for £35 per month plus SE W810i, but upgrade isnt due until 1st June.

So, after reading some of the deals people have got on here i think i'm just gonna try and pretend to cancel before 1st of June, so i can try and get my price plan cut down.
Before i phone though i'd love to find a deal better than they've offered me so i can quote it to them and see if they can beat it.

Only one i can find so far is T mobile 500 mins and 700 texts, also £35 per month (and w810i for £9.99)

Can anyone point me in the direction of a cheaper and better deal, or give me some advice before i phone?

    Take a look at the O2 Retentions thread in this forum - it should be on the first page most of the time. A lot of people have managed to haggle out similar deals to yours for about £20-25 a month. Whether you'll actually get such an offer depends on your past monthly spend, of course, but you've lost some negotiating power by accepting the offer they gave you.
